TW511教學網
全部教學
技術文章
技術文章
»
iOS14 隱私適配:【定位授權新增了精確和模糊定位 可根據不同的需求設定不同的定位精確度】1、向使用者申請臨時開啟一次精確位置許可權的方案(不同場景可定義不同purposeKey)2、高德定位SDK
iOS14 隱私適配:【定位授權新增了精確和模糊定位 可根據不同的需求設定不同的定位精確度】1、向使用者申請臨時開啟一次精確位置許可權的方案(不同場景可定義不同purposeKey)2、高德定位SDK
2020-09-22 15:01:53
文章目錄
前言
I、向使用者申請臨時開啟一次精確位置許可權:不同產品場景可以定義不同的purposeKey
1.1 注意事項
1.2 、控制授予APP的定位精度等級:根據不同的需求設定不同的定位精確度
1.2.1 通過API設定不同的定位精確度
1.2.2 通過info.plist關閉精確定位許可權的方法
II、 高德定位SDK適配:「模糊定位」許可權下的相容策略
2.1、plist設定NSLocationTemporaryUsageDescriptionDictionary
2.2、locationAccuracyMode設定為AMapLocationFullAndReduceAccuracy/AMapLocationFullAccuracy
2. 3實現代理方法
2.4 處理定位許可權狀態改變的回撥函數